U11 Hurling Round Up - March 2023

Our U11 Boys mainly made up of 2012 and 2013 born boys have had a busy start to the season with lots of training, coaching and blitzes in recent weeks.

To date all training has been conducted in our arena with the boys getting invaluable attention as they were working with our coaches in the Foundation Level and Level 1 coaching courses.

Trip to Cusack Park

Our first trip onto the turf in 2023 was a visit to Cusack Park to play at half time in the Clare V Cork League game. This is a new initiative from Clare GAA and proved really popular for our 2012 boys who hurled outstanding against the Clarecastle Magpies. Looking forward to plenty more days for these boys in the future at Clare GAA HQ, The anticipation etched on their faces says it all as they wait for the half time whistle in the Senior game ....

Go Games Blitzes

This year we are fielding 3 teams in the Clare GAA Go Games Blitz series - last Sunday say round 1 take place when we hosted Eire Og, Parteen/Meelick and Whitegate.

Na Piarsaigh Visit

Last night we made the short visit across the border to play Na Piarsaigh - Both clubs fielded 2 teams of 11 a side in a very entertaining encounter. One of the highlights for the Bridge was the performance of goalkeeper Lorcan who was the talk of the blitz following some outstanding saves he made throughout. One for the future no doubt.

Coaches

Congratulations to all our U11 coaches who completed the Foundation Level and Level 1 course - We are proud to say 100% of our coaches are Foundation level certified while 75% are level 1 certified while 50% have done the fundamental movement course with Martin Bennett which means the boys are in good hands as we try to develop their hurling and movement skills.

Cathal Malone visits Training

Last week we had a nice surprise when Cathal Malone dropped in on training and had a chat with the boys following by some very interesting questions in the Q&A that followed.

Cathal is the second superstar to visit with Seadhna Morey having called in to see us earlier this year.
